The Exchange is a blog hosted by Ryder System, Inc. that provides thought leadership on a variety of fleet, supply chain and logistics-related topics. Whether you’re just getting familiar with supply chain issues or you’re a seasoned expert, this is your place.
We created this blog to provide a platform for sharing educational information such as current industry trends, hot topics and best practices, perspectives and commentary. You’ll also find links to interesting supply chain news and features. Most of all, Exchange is a forum for professionals to present questions to Ryder and foster informed dialog.
